Located near Poole on the South Coast of
England, this language school was founded in 1971 and achieves excellent
academic results. Students from up to 10 different nationalities study here at
the same time, so you will get to learn about other cultures as well as English.
Allowing a maximum of 12 students in a class, Wessex Academy School of
English Poole offers a range of courses for adults (16+). This includes General
English, 24-44 weeks Long Term General English, a Beginners English course, 6
and 9 month Academic Year courses, Business English and examination preparation
courses for the Cambridge Papers, IELTS, TOIEC and TOEFL. The Summer General
English and Pisces Summer Course for 12-17 year olds offer packages of lessons
and accommodation.

Midway between Poole and Bournemouth on Bournemouth Road is where you will
find Wessex Academy School of English Poole. Poole itself is a costal town and
port on the South Coast of England.
Poole harbour is renowned for being
the second largest natural harbour in Europe. It's a haven for water sports
fanatics! You can head down to the Quayside to go on a harbour cruise, visit
Brownsea Island Nature reserve, or see hand made Poole Pottery. You can even
catch a ferry from here to go to the Channel Islands and France, or explore the
range of pubs, restaurants and cafes on offer.
